21xrx.com
2024-09-20 00:11:26 Friday
登录
文章检索 我的文章 写文章
C++求职需要达到的技能水平是什么?
2023-06-26 19:37:02 深夜i     --     --
C++ 求职 技能水平

C++是一门高级编程语言,广泛应用于开发高性能、复杂的软件和应用程序。对于想要从事C++开发的人来说,了解C++求职需要达到的技能水平是非常重要的。

首先是语言基础。作为一门编程语言,C++的语法和语言特性是必须要掌握的。C++程序员需要熟悉C++的各种数据类型、运算符、控制结构、函数、指针等基础语法,以及其它和面向对象编程相关的内容,比如类、继承、虚函数等等。另外,C++还涉及到一些比较高级的语言特性,例如多线程编程、模板编程、异常处理、智能指针等等,这些也都需要掌握。

其次是编程技能。作为一名C++程序员,你需要具备独立完成软件开发的能力。这需要你具备良好的面向对象编程思想和编程实践经验,比如熟练使用设计模式、善于进行代码重构,以及代码编写规范、文档编写等实践技能。此外,还需要能够熟练使用调试工具,以及对代码进行性能优化,使得软件能够具备良好的性能。

第三是库和框架的掌握。在C++开发过程中,使用现有的库和框架是提高软件开发效率和质量的常用手段。比如在做图形界面开发时,可以使用Qt这种跨平台GUI库,来减少重复工作和提高开发效率。另外,C++开发过程中经常用到的库还包括Boost、STL等。掌握这些库和框架,能够使得程序员更快速、更高效地完成开发任务。

最后是团队协作能力。现代软件开发更加注重协作和沟通,因此C++程序员也需要有一定的团队协作能力。这需要你具备良好的沟通能力、分析问题和解决问题的能力,以及在团队中承担自己分内的任务和责任的能力。

综上所述,作为一名C++程序员,需要掌握C++的语法和语言特性,拥有独立完成软件开发任务的能力,掌握库和框架,以及具备团队协作能力。这些才是C++求职所需要达到的技能水平。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复